
Here is a delicious recipe for Steak with Garlic Cream Sauce – perfect for a hearty and creamy dish!
Ingredients:
For the steak:
- 2 beef steaks (e.g., ribeye or filet)
- Salt & pepper to taste
- 1 tbsp olive oil
- 1 tbsp butter
For the garlic cream sauce:
- 3 garlic cloves, finely chopped
- 1 tbsp butter
- 200 ml heavy cream
- 50 g Parmesan cheese, grated
- 1 tsp Dijon mustard (optional)
- 1 tsp lemon juice
- Salt & p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ley for garnish
Instructions:
- Prepare the steaks: Take the steaks out of the refrigerator 30 minutes before cooking and season with salt and pepper.
- Sear the steaks: Heat a pan over medium-high heat, add olive oil and butter. Sear the steaks for about 3-4 minutes per side (for medium-rare). Remove from the pan and let them rest.
- Make the garlic cream sauce: In the same pan, melt the butter and sauté the chopped garlic briefly. Add the heavy cream, Parmesan cheese, mustard, and lemon juice. Stir and let it simmer for a few minutes until the sauce thickens slightly. Season with salt and pepper.
- Serve: Pour the hot sauce over the steaks, garnish with fresh parsley, and enjoy!
Tip: This goes perfectly with crispy potatoes or steamed vegetables.
